private codebases - real ones, not demos or toys that models & harnesses can keep enough in context alive to be effective, but monsters that cause the frontier models to still degrade even now. Models adapted to the particular workflows of particular dev teams, adherence to a specific companies internal policies. ICL can't cover everything, at some point a custom finetune is cheaper than 300k tokens of context on every request.

There's also data ownership too, especially where some entity is regulated to not allow data outside the country (sometimes even not to a third party at all for some providers, esp government)

There's still just cost optimisation as well - if smaller & faster finetuned model x is $1 for 1b tokens, and GPT-9-luna is still $10 for the same amount, and the workflow is running thousands of times per day (or more), better to slap a ft on the small model.

the thing is, right now the services required you're talking about doesn't quite exist - there's Thinking Machines & Prime Intellect working in that direction I guess, but the unit economics still don't quite make sense. The story isn't clean enough yet. Who is creating the evals, the envs, arranging the SFT corpus in all this? But, in a few years it'll be viable
